Output 84bc1baf50cedbb392418ce5bc8e7d86640fa8d8b5576626b95eb64f6f564c1c:0

value
472577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e5bc153a35bbbe401319b9928dc9421b67a6f2 OP_EQUAL
address
3EzT7c6SQfH8LyZEjqeGJHDEQUq7EshHFJ
transaction
84bc1baf50cedbb392418ce5bc8e7d86640fa8d8b5576626b95eb64f6f564c1c
spent
true